What skills and experience we're looking for

Required from November 2024, a Technician to provide technical and administrative support and practical assistance, primarily to the Design & Technology and Art departments but with flexibility to support other departments as required.

Having achieved the best results in the school’s history in summer 2023, followed by a visit from Ofsted in May 2024, where we were judged as a strong ‘Good’ in all areas, Buckler’s Mead Academy is going from strength to strength.

A vacancy has arisen for an enthusiastic Technician from November 2024. The post is 37 hours per week, term time only plus 2 additional INSET days. The successful candidate should be confident in the use of technical and practical equipment and with an interest in design, technology, art and craftsmanship.

Main Duties and Responsibilities include:

Preparing classrooms and workshops for use by staff and students, ensuring a safe and tidy working environment

Assisting and supporting teaching staff in delivering practical activities in lessons

Working with teaching staff in the creation of teaching resources and materials

Maintaining, cleaning and repairing equipment (seeking specialist assistance when necessary) in order to ensure safe and efficient operation

Commitment to safeguarding

Buckler's Mead is committed to safeguarding and protecting the welfare of children.

We have a duty of care and the right to take reasonable action, ensuring the welfare and safety of pupils. If staff have cause for concern that a child is subject to any form of abuse, we will follow child protection procedures and inform Children’s Services.

Buckler’s Mead meets statutory requirements relating to Disclosure & Barring Service – all staff and volunteers who work with Buckler’s Mead Academy who meet the ‘regulated activity test’ (Freedoms Act 2012) are required to undergo an enhanced DBS check prior to employment.

Originally established as Buckler's Mead School in 1957, Buckler’s Mead Academy is now a successful 11- 16 academy where we pride ourselves on providing an inspiring education for all. This is achieved through a strong sense of community, providing a wide range of opportunities, ensuring students enjoy school and are ultimately successful in their chosen field.

We believe in providing a learning environment that is calm, orderly and respectful, where our students can reach their full potential and go on to be happy, successful and fulfilled members of the community.

In September 2021 the Academy joined the Midsomer Norton Partnership Trust. This is a strong trust of more than 25 schools, including 11 secondary schools. The trust is often described as the 'market leader' in the South West and has an exceptional record for providing high quality educational provision to all of its students.
